This surprise from the ECM vault pairs Keith Jarrett’s recordings of piano concertos by Samuel Barber and Béla Bartók from Germany in 1984 and Japan in 1985, respectively. Whereas Barber’s only work for this format overflows with color, opening the curtain to a landscape of lush variety and sensory allure, Bartók’s second soars above Jarrett’s thermals with all the folk-tinged brilliance one would expect. Following this, we get a balladic improvisation from Jarrett alone called “Tokyo Encore—Nothing But A Dream.” Indeed, this is what it feels like to get here and wonder what lies next.
